The Menu meets Ready or Not in this dark tale of opulent luxury and shocking violence from the New York Times bestselling author of Bloom.

Thrift fashionista Dez Lane doesn't want to date Patrick Ruskin; she just wants to meet his mother, the editor-in-chief of Nouveau magazine. When he invites her to his family's big Easter reunion at their ancestral home, she's certain she can put up with his arrogance and fend off his advances long enough to ask Marie Caulfield-Ruskin for an internship someone with her pedigree could never nab through the regular submission route.

When they arrive at the enormous island mansion, Dez is floored-she's never witnessed how the 1% lives before in all their ridiculous, unnecessary luxury. But once all the family members are on the island and the ferry has departed, things take a dark turn. For decades, the Ruskins have made their servants sign contracts that are basically indentured servitude, and with nothing to lose, the servants have decided their only route to freedom is to get rid of the Ruskins for good . . .

Fashionista Dez Lane dates Patrick Ruskin, hoping to meet his mother; the editor-in-chief of Nouveau magazine. When Patrick mentions he’ll be attending his family’s big Easter reunion at their ancestral home, Dez jumps at the chance to attend. Set on a remote island, the tale that unfolds will shock and terrify you as family members end up dead with scenes straight out of a movie horror flick.

While the Ruskins may be ultra wealthy, let’s just say their desire to be the best comes at a cost. NDAs, sacrifices, and indentured servants. Now it’s time for them to pay. Wow, talk about chills and thrills. Dawson holds nothing back with this atmospheric horror perfect for Halloween. The servants are out for revenge. Will Dez survive? Will anyone?

If you love remote settings, gore, suspense and shocking revelations, you won’t want to miss Guillotine. This is a listen that stays with you. My heart was racing as I devoured this cringe-worthy tale. Dawson unpacks a slew of topics concerning privilege, entitlement, revenge and more.

Narrated by Elisabeth Ashby, we witness firsthand the horror as Des fights to survive the unimaginable. Ashby did a fantastic job of giving voice to Dez and the Ruskins. Listening elevated the terror.

About Delilah S. Dawson

Delilah S. Dawson

Delilah S. Dawson writes whimsical and dark Fantasy for adults and teens. Her Blud series for Pocket includes Wicked as They Come, Wicked After Midnight, and Wicked as She Wants, winner of the RT Book Reviews Steampunk Book of the Year and May Seal of Excellence for 2013. Her YA debut, Servants of the Storm, is a Southern Gothic Horror set in Savannah, GA, and HIT is about teen assassins in a bank-owned America. Her Geekrotica series under pseudonym Ava Lovelace includes The Lumberfox and The Superfox with The Dapperfox on the way. Look for Wake of Vultures from Orbit Books in October 2015, written as Lila Bowen.

About Elisabeth Ashby

Elisabeth Ashby

Elisabeth Ashby is a seasoned character actor and singer with over two decades of stage experience. Having loved audiobooks since she was a little girl checking cassettes out from the local library, she is thrilled to have found a way to combine her love of performing with her lifelong passion for the written word as a narrator. Originally from Upstate New York, she now lives in Central Virginia with her husband and two cats.
